Clinical characteristics and prognostic analysis of patients with NMOSD-ON and MOGAD-ON

Abstract:  Objective To compare and analyze the clinical characteristics and treatment efficacy between patients with neuromyelitis optica spectrum disorders associated optic neuritis (NMOSD-ON) and myelin oligodendrocyte glycoprotein antibody disease associated optic neuritis (MOGAD-ON). Design Retrospective case series. Participants Forty patients (53 eyes) diagnosed with NMOSD-ON and MOGAD-ON at the Ophthalmology Center of Affiliated Hospital of Shandong Second Medical University from December 2021 to December 2024. Methods Patients were divided into NMOSD-ON group (18 patients, 22 eyes) and MOGAD-ON group (22 patients, 31 eyes) based on serum antibody results. The two groups were compared in terms of demographic characteristics, clinical manifestations (including visual acuity, ocular pain, optic disc edema), peripapillary retinal nerve fiber layer (RNFL) thickness, cranial/orbital magnetic resonance imaging (MRI) findings, treatment outcomes, and recurrence. Main Outcome Measures Demographic characteristics, clinical manifestations, best corrected visual acuity (BCVA) before and after treatment, RNFL thickness, treatment response rate, and recurrence rate. Results The proportion of females in the NMOSD-ON group was significantly higher than that in the MOGAD-ON group (88.9% vs. 50.0%, P=0.009). The age at first onset in the NMOSD-ON group was significantly older than that in the MOGAD-ON group (55.00±14.41 years vs. 24.05±16.40 years, P<0.001). The incidence of optic disc edema was significantly higher in the MOGAD-ON group than in the NMOSD-ON group (74.2% vs. 13.7%, P<0.001). The proportion of eyes with pretreatment BCVA≤0.1 was 81.8% in the NMOSD-ON group and 54.8% in the MOGAD-ON group (P=0.041). At initial presentation, both superior and temporal RNFL thicknesses in the NMOSD-ON group were lower than those in the MOGAD-ON group (both P<0.05). At the early follow-up visit (1-3 months after treatment), the rate of visual improvement (including both complete recovery and partial improvement) in the NMOSD-ON group was 36.3%, significantly inferior to the 90.4% observed in the MOGAD-ON group (P<0.001). The 1-year recurrence rates were 44.4% and 36.4% for the NMOSD-ON and MOGAD-ON groups, respectively, with no significant difference (P=0.604). Conclusions NMOSD-ON predominantly affects middle-aged and elderly individuals, with a female predominance. It presents with more severe initial visual impairment, more pronounced RNFL thinning, and poorer visual recovery after standard high-dose corticosteroid pulse therapy compared to MOGAD-ON. MOGAD-ON is more common in young people and children, has a higher incidence of optic disc edema, but shows a better response to corticosteroid therapy.
